description | The present invention relates to a device for driving a print head of an image forming apparatus. More particularly, the present invention is directed to a circuit for generating an adjustable control voltage applied to electrodes in a print head of a charge deposition printing system.
The present invention provides a method and circuit for driving control electrodes between a reset voltage and an adjustable control voltage. The circuit includes a reset switch capable of assuming a first state and a second state, the reset switch including a first terminal connected to a first voltage source; a plurality of diodes, each one of the plurality connected between a second terminal of the reset switch and a corresponding one of the control electrodes; and a plurality of voltage control switches, each voltage control switch being capable of assuming an active state and an inactive state, each voltage control switch including a first terminal connected to a corresponding one of the control electrodes and a second terminal connected to a second voltage source, wherein the extraction voltage supplied to a control electrode is adjusted by adjusting the length of time that the corresponding voltage source is made active. |
